Webbaptism, a sacrament of admission to Christianity. The forms and rituals of the various Christian churches vary, but baptism almost invariably involves the use of water and the Trinitarian invocation, “I baptize you: In the name of the Father, and of the Son, and of the Holy Spirit.” The candidate may be wholly or partly immersed in water, the water may be … WebBaptised and baptized are two different spellings of the same word. Baptised is the preferred spelling in British English. Baptized is the preferred spelling in American English. …
